Engine and Transmission Parts

The engine and transmission are the heart of your Jeep Cherokee. Regular maintenance and timely replacement of these parts can significantly extend the life of your vehicle. Key engine and transmission parts include:

  • Air Filters: Essential for keeping the engine clean and efficient.
  • Oil Filters: Crucial for maintaining engine lubrication and performance.
  • Spark Plugs: Necessary for igniting the fuel-air mixture in the engine.
  • Transmission Fluid: Ensures smooth gear shifting and protects the transmission.
  • Timing Belts: Synchronizes the rotation of the crankshaft and camshaft.

Suspension and Steering Parts

The suspension and steering systems are vital for a smooth and safe driving experience. These parts help absorb shocks and maintain control over the vehicle. Important suspension and steering parts include:

  • Shock Absorbers: Dampen the impact of bumps and potholes.
  • Control Arms: Connect the suspension to the vehicle’s frame.
  • Ball Joints: Allow the suspension to pivot and move smoothly.
  • Steering Rack: Transfers the driver’s input to the wheels.
  • Tie Rods: Connect the steering rack to the wheels.

Braking System Parts

A reliable braking system is crucial for safety. Regular inspection and replacement of braking parts can prevent accidents and ensure your Jeep Cherokee stops effectively. Key braking system parts include:

  • Brake Pads: Provide the friction needed to stop the vehicle.
  • Brake Rotors: Work with brake pads to slow down the vehicle.
  • Brake Calipers: Apply pressure to the brake pads.
  • Brake Fluid: Transfers force from the brake pedal to the brakes.
  • Brake Lines: Carry brake fluid to the brakes.

Common Issues with Jeep Cherokee Parts

Jeep Cherokee owners may encounter various issues with their vehicle’s parts. Understanding these common problems can help you address them promptly. Here are some frequent issues:

Engine and Transmission Problems

Engine and transmission issues can significantly affect your Jeep Cherokee’s performance. Common problems include:

  • Engine overheating due to coolant leaks or a faulty thermostat.
  • Transmission slipping or delayed shifting due to low fluid levels or worn-out parts.
  • Engine misfires caused by faulty spark plugs or ignition coils.

Suspension and Steering Issues

Suspension and steering problems can compromise your vehicle’s handling and safety. Common issues include:

  • Worn-out shock absorbers leading to a bumpy ride.
  • Loose or damaged control arms causing steering instability.
  • Worn-out ball joints resulting in clunking noises and poor handling.

Braking System Problems

Braking system issues can be dangerous and should be addressed immediately. Common problems include:

  • Worn-out brake pads causing squeaking or grinding noises.
  • Warped brake rotors leading to vibration during braking.
  • Leaking brake fluid resulting in reduced braking performance.
